377887024238370624375052682227470896970310
Even
377887024238370624375052682227470896970310 is even
Previous even number is 377887024238370624375052682227470896970308
Next even number is 377887024238370624375052682227470896970312
Cubed
53961739186218835826057800176459480140018260640919949155486104873949454866752223879603921393910686051873068602050833480791000
Squared
142798603087730907765041590425265796536978534266205272369943888711317387137021496100
Binary
1000101011010000010100110011000111010111111010010011010010101010100111111011111001100001101100000101000001110000111100000111011101001000110